Recipes and mixes
A recipe stores settings for generating again: artists, filters, groups and limits. A mix is a specific selection of tracks. Save a recipe to revisit an idea; save a mix to keep the exact result. Check for unsaved changes before opening another recipe.

Artists, groups and proportions
Choose artists and track counts. Groups define relative shares. Advanced filters can require all or any selected criteria; exclusions reject matching recordings. Artist-specific rules refine the selection for an individual artist.

Years, live recordings and albums
Year filters restrict eligible recordings. Choose live or studio versions; filling a live shortfall with studio recordings only happens when explicitly enabled. Album limits cap tracks from one release. Strict filters may produce a shorter result: read the generation report.

Duration and pinned tracks
The target duration is a budget, not a promise of an exact length. The engine selects tracks that fit while balancing artist and group shares. Pinned tracks count toward duration and shares. Changing filters, pins or limits can change the result.

Apple Music and discovery
Your MixRule account and Apple Music authorization are separate. Playback and playlist export need the appropriate Apple Music access. Discovery depends on service configuration and artist matching; ambiguous matches may need correction. MixRule does not provide an Apple Music subscription.

Collection and sync
Start on iPhone. Return to your mix on a bigger screen. Recipes and saved mixes sync when you sign in to the same MixRule account. Your account synchronizes saved data. Compare versions before resolving a conflict. Settings provides export, import and available recovery copies. Export your collection before a major change.
